Default First Jaguar after years of Infiniti's and other stuff

Hello to all. I am a new member with my first Jaguar. I recently purchased a 2014 FType V8S and have already posted a picture in the Ftype section. It's white with a red convertible roof and red interior. Great black 20inch wheels and just a beautiful horsepower monster. I just love it.

If anything I have to fully agree with Jeremy Clarkson's review where he said the Ftype was an "engine in the front, drive to the rear and a big smiling piece of meat in the middle"! After a week I am still that smiling piece of meat.
I live in south central Pennsylvania just north of Baltimore. Spend my Saturday's at Cars and Coffee in Hunt Valley and now I have a real reason to be there. After 30+ years of driving Saabs, Volvos, 6 different Infiniti's and a Mercedes SLK 250, I've finally gotten a car with real power style and class. The looks and comments are just staggering. Looking forward to many years of happy motoring and I'm sure a ticket or three.
Attached is a photo from Hunt Valley this Saturday. Hardly anyone even looked at the Lambo!
